Transport options for Siloam Springs
- Stretcher transport: Recumbent stretcher service for passengers who must remain flat or semi-reclined on the road out of Siloam Springs, Arkansas, with continuous attendant support.
- Wheelchair transport: ADA-oriented wheelchair vehicles for secure long-haul travel to and from Siloam Springs, Arkansas, including door-through-door assistance when appropriate.
- Ambulatory support: Assisted ambulatory transport for riders who can walk short distances but need supervision and comfort management across multi-hour Siloam Springs, Arkansas itineraries.

Questions about planning a trip
How are Siloam Springs, Arkansas quotes calculated?
Quotes reflect loaded miles, vehicle type (wheelchair, stretcher, ambulatory), attendant needs, wait time, and any special equipment. Use the quote form for a trip-specific estimate.
What medical levels can you support from Siloam Springs, Arkansas?
We focus on non-emergency wheelchair, stretcher, and ambulatory passengers. If a higher acute level of care is required, a coordinator can discuss appropriateness before a trip is confirmed.
How far in advance should we book transport involving Siloam Springs, Arkansas?
Booking long-distance transport involving Siloam Springs, Arkansas several days ahead gives time to review vehicle type, staffing needs, and facility windows. Share the requested date and both addresses so a coordinator can assess the itinerary.
